Allen Kessler completed and he was called by three players including Perry Friedman and Hila Elezra, who is the wife of Eli Elezra, also in the tournament.
On fourth, action checked to Elezra and she bet. All three of her opponents called. On fifth, Elezra bet again but this time only Friedman called.
On sixth street, Elezra one more time and Friedman called one more time. Friedman called one final bet on seventh street, but he was shown ![]()
![]()
for a pair and a low. It was good enough to take down the pot so Friedman sent over the chips, leaving himself with right around 15,000. Elezra took down the pot and chipped up to 15,000.
Her husband, Eli, mentioned that Hila only plays one tournament every year, and she's been chugging along so far, making through the first nine levels of the day.

Event #25 has closed registration with 596 entries, creating a prize pool of $804,600. The WSOP has determined the payouts, which will see the winner take home $173,528 while a min-cash in 90th will be worth $2,246. Check the corresponding tab above for full payout information.
